Inverse Identiy
Yan Lu, pursued by enemies, accidentally kidnaps Jian An, the adopted heir of the Jian family. After failing to escape, Yan Lu becomes Jian An’s reluctant bodyguard. Their dynamic shifts as Jian An, intrigued by Yan Lu, playfully torments him. A fight reveals a birthmark on Yan Lu, hinting at deeper secrets. When Jian An loses his memory, he relies on Yan Lu, leading to a growing bond between them. However, as Jian An’s memories return, he fears the truth will come out, unaware that Yan Lu understands everything and only wants to protect him.
